Abstract

Road crashes are the leading cause of death and hospital admission for people under the age of 45 years in the European Union. There are 40 000 road deaths a year, and the European Commission has recently set an ambitious target to reduce road deaths by 50% by 2010. But meeting this goal requires the European Union to perform better as a whole than any one member state has to date. (A)
